Output 32cbc7bd0ae40358c4340e86bd343f0c831ec5fcf059e5228ba26721916b0faf:3

value
67330577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a368fe27e24d7b4259f4ecf3cdfe6e4760c142e4 OP_EQUAL
address
MNoC9j4D8ZyUgxYhMckvNTn78KFW2h5b7E
transaction
32cbc7bd0ae40358c4340e86bd343f0c831ec5fcf059e5228ba26721916b0faf
spent
true